Compared to last week; Steer calves steady to 6.00 higher. Heifer calves under 500 lbs. steady to 4.00 higher, over 500 lbs. 2.00 to 5.00 lower. Demand was good. Quality was average through attractive. Slaughter cows steady to 1.00 higher. Slaughter bulls 1.00 lower. A total of 330 cows and bulls sold with 85 percent going to packers.

What does "Medium and Large 1" mean?

USDA feeder grades describe frame size and muscle thickness, not quality of the individual animal. "Medium and Large" is the frame score; the number is muscle (1 = heaviest muscled). "Medium and Large 1–2" pens mix both muscle scores — common across the Southeast.

What is $/cwt?

Dollars per hundredweight — per 100 lb of animal. A 500-lb calf at $450/cwt brings 5 × $450 = $2,250. Lighter cattle usually bring more per cwt but less per head.

Why are some prices per head?

Bred cows, cow-calf pairs, and some replacement classes sell by the head, not by weight. We show those exactly as USDA reports them — a $/head figure is never converted into $/cwt on this site.
